Re: Retirement of the Stonebriar product line

Stonebriar sales have declined for five consecutive quarters and support costs now exceed contribution margin. The retirement plan is staged: new orders close end of Q2, existing contracts honoured through their terms, and spares stocked for twenty-four months. Sales leads should steer prospects toward the Ashgrove range; migration incentives are already approved. Customer comms are drafted and awaiting legal sign-off. The forward strategy behind this decision is set out in the note below.

confidential, yafog-hagug: Gross margin on Druix came in at 10 percent against a plan of 15 percent. Only 5 of the 80 pilot accounts renewed Druix, so a churn review is set for October 1.

Subject: Inventory reconciliation job — schedule change in Orchardgate 5.1

Hello plugin authors — the nightly inventory reconciliation job now runs in two phases: a read-only diff pass, then a correction pass twenty minutes later. Plugins hooking the stock-adjusted event will now fire during the second phase only. Please retest any automation that reacts to stock corrections. Validate against the release candidate identified by the token below.

session token of tajef-bageg = htk21_5d90d574934f3ccae6437

## Step 5: Update Your Cache Invalidation Settings

Following the stale-cache incident described in the Fennwright postmortem, plugin authors must adopt the new invalidation contract in SDK v2.3. Plugins that set their own TTLs are no longer honored; the host now controls expiry centrally. Remove any local cache headers your plugin emits, then align your development environment with the host's expected settings, which are listed in full below.

config for yadug-kawep:
ralwyn:
  log_level: debug
  metrics_host: metrics.ralwyn.qorvellabs.internal
  pool_size: 4